Перейти к содержимому

Как заполнить формулами интервал ячеек

  • автор:

Заполнение формулой смежных ячеек

Вы можете быстро скопировать формулы в смежные ячейки, перетащив . При заполнении формул вниз будут заложены относительные ссылки, чтобы гарантировать, что формулы будут корректироваться для каждой строки, если не включить абсолютные или смешанные ссылки перед заполнением формулы вниз.

Чтобы заполнить формулу и выбрать параметры для применения, выполните указанные здесь действия.

  1. Выделите ячейку, которая содержит формулу для заполнения смежных ячеек.
  2. Перетащите маркер заполнения по ячейкам, которые вы хотите заполнить. Если маркер не отображается, возможно, он скрыт. Чтобы снова отобразить его:
    1. Щелкните Параметры >файла
    2. Выберите пункт Дополнительно.
    3. В окне Параметры правкив поле Включить перетаскивать ячейки и заполнять ячейки.

    Дополнительные сведения о копировании формул см. в статье Копирование и вставка формулы в другую ячейку или на другой лист.

    Заполнение смежных ячеек формулами

    Для заполнения формулы смежным диапазоном ячеек можно использовать команду Заполнить. Просто сделайте следующее:

    1. Вы выберите ячейку с формулой и смежные ячейки, которые нужно заполнить.
    2. Щелкните Главная >заливкаи выберите Вниз ,Справа,Вверхили Влево.

    Включить вычисление книги

    При заполнении ячеек формулы не пересчитыются, если автоматическое вычисление книги не включено.

    Вот как его можно включить:

    1. Выберите Файл >Параметры.
    2. Щелкните Формулы.
    3. В области Вычисления в книгевыберите Авто.

    Маркер заполнения

    1. Выделите ячейку, которая содержит формулу для заполнения смежных ячеек.
    2. Перетащите вниз или вправо от нужного столбца.

    Сочетания клавиш: Можно также нажать CTRL+D, чтобы заполнить формулой ячейку в столбце, или CTRL+R, чтобы заполнить формулой ячейку справа в строке.

    Дополнительные сведения

    Вы всегда можете задать вопрос эксперту в Excel Tech Community или получить поддержку в сообществах.

    Excel: Автозаполнение (часть 1)

    Иногда в Excel приходится вводить однотипные данные в определенной последовательности, например дни недели, даты или порядковые номера строк. Для автоматизации таких процессов разработчики внедрили в программу очень удобную функцию, которая называется Автозаполнение ячеек.

    Автозаполнение смежных ячеек

    В правом нижнем углу текущей ячейки имеется черный квадратик – маркер заполнения.

    При наведении указателя мыши на этот маркер, он приобретает форму тонкого черного крестика.

    Для проведения Автозаполнения:

    • введите значение в ячейку
    • снова сделать ячейку активной
    • наведите курсор на маркер заполнения, при появлении черного крестика нажмите на него левой или правой кнопкой мыши и, не отпуская кнопку, «протяните» маркер в нужном направлении по горизонтали или по вертикали
    • список заполнится автоматически, после того как кнопка будет отпущена.

    Автозаполнение используют в разных целях:

    • Копирование данных в другие ячейки (числа, текст, формулы);
    • Создание арифметических и геометрических прогрессий;
    • Создание различных последовательностей (названия месяцев, дни недели, даты, время);
    • Создание пользовательских последовательностей;
    • Копирование оформления ячеек.

    Примеры автозаполнения :

    Ряды, полученные с помощью автозаполнения

    Автозаполнение смежных ячеек числами

    1. Протягивание левой кнопкой мыши маркера ячейки, содержащей число, скопирует это число в последующие ячейки. Если при протягивании маркера удерживать клавишу , то ячейки будут заполнены последовательными числами

    Разбивка текста

    Кнопка: Смарт-тег

    При протягивании вправо или вниз числовое значение увеличивается, при протягивании влево или вверх – уменьшается. По ходу протягивания на экране появляется всплывающая подсказка, которая показывает то значение, которое программа собирается вставить в следующую ячейку.
    Кнопка , которая появляется рядом с последней заполненной ячейкой, называется смарт-тегом автозаполнения . Щелкнув по этой кнопке, можно выбрать тип автозаполнения ячеек.

    Разбивка текста Разбивка текста

    2. При протягивании маркера заполнения правой кнопкой мыши появится контекстное меню, в котором можно выбрать нужную команду:

    Разбивка текста

    • Копировать – все ячейки будут содержать одно и то же число;
    • Заполнить – ячейки будут содержать последовательные значения (с шагом арифметической прогрессии 1).

    Заполнение числами с шагом отличным от 1

    • заполнить две соседние ячейки нужными значениями;
    • выделить эти ячейки;
    • протянуть маркер заполнения.

    Разбивка текста

    Таким образом, для сложных последовательностей, перед применением автозаполнения, необходимо самостоятельно заполнить сразу несколько ячеек, чтобы Excel правильно смог определить общий алгоритм вычисления их значений.

    • ввести начальное значение в первую ячейку;
    • протянуть маркер заполнения правой кнопкой мыши;
    • в контекстном меню выбрать команду Прогрессия ;
    • в диалоговом окне выбрать тип прогрессии – арифметическая и установить нужную величину шага (в нашем примере это – 3).

    Заполнение датами

    При автозаполнении дат можно выбрать: заполнение по дням, месяцам, годам, а также по рабочим дням.

    Как автоматически заполнить ячейки в MS Excel с большими таблицами

    В программе Excel существует много приемов для быстрого и эффективного заполнения ячеек данными. Всем известно, что лень – это двигатель прогресса. Знают об этом и разработчики.

    На заполнение данных приходится тратить большую часть времени на скучную и рутинную работу. Например, заполнение табеля учета рабочего времени или расходной накладной и т.п.

    Рассмотрим приемы автоматического и полуавтоматического заполнения в Excel. А так же, какими инструментами обладают электронные таблицы для облегчения труда пользователя. Научимся применять их в практике и узнаем насколько они эффективные.

    Как в Excel заполнить ячейки одинаковыми значениями?

    Сначала рассмотрим, как автоматически заполнять ячейки в Excel. Для примера заполним наполовину незаполненную исходную таблицу.

    Таблица для заполнения.

    Это небольшая табличка только на примере и ее можно было заполнить вручную. Но в практике иногда приходится заполнять по 30 тысяч строк. Чтобы не заполнять эту исходную таблицу вручную следует создать формулу для заполнения в Excel данными – автоматически. Для этого следует выполнить ряд последовательных действий:

    1. Перейдите на любую пустую ячейку исходной таблицы.
    2. Выберите инструмент: «Главная»-«Найти и выделить»-«Перейти» (или нажмите горячие клавиши CTRL+G).
    3. В появившемся окне щелкните на кнопку «Выделить».
    4. В появившемся окне выберите опцию «пустые ячейки» и нажмите ОК. Все незаполненные ячейки выделены.
    5. Теперь введите формулу «=A1» и нажмите комбинацию клавиш CTRL+Enter. Так выполняется заполнение пустых ячеек в Excel предыдущим значением – автоматически. Заполнение пустых ячеек.
    6. Выделите колонки A:B и скопируйте их содержимое.
    7. Выберите инструмент: «Главная»-«Вставить»-«Специальная вставка» (или нажмите CTRL+ALT+V).
    8. В появившемся окне выберите опцию «значения» и нажмите Ок. Теперь исходная таблица заполнена не просто формулами, а естественными значениями ячеек.

    Результат авто-заполнения.

    При заполнении 30-ти тысяч строк невозможно не допустить ошибки. Выше приведенный способ не только экономит силы и время, но и исключает возникновение ошибок вызванных человеческим фактором.

    Внимание! В 5-том пункте таблица красиво заполнилась без ошибок, так как наша активная ячейка была по адресу A2, после выполнения 4-го пункта. При использовании данного метода будьте внимательны и следите за тем где находится активная ячейка после выделения. Важно откуда она будет брать свои значения.

    Полуавтоматическое заполнение ячеек в Excel из выпадающего списка

    Теперь в полуавтоматическом режиме можно заполнить пустые ячейки. У только несколько значений, которые повторяются в последовательном или случайном порядке.

    В новой исходной таблице автоматически заполните колонки C и D соответствующие им данными.

    Полуавтоматическое заполнение ячеек.

    1. Заполните заголовки колонок C1 – «Дата» и D1 – «Тип платежа».
    2. В ячейку C2 введите дату 18.07.2015
    3. В ячейках С2:С4 даты повторяются. Поэтому выделяем диапазон С2:С4 и нажимаем комбинацию клавиш CTRL+D, чтобы автоматически заполнить ячейки предыдущими значениями.
    4. Введите текущею дату в ячейку C5. Для этого нажмите комбинацию клавиш CTRL+; (точка с запятой на английской раскладке клавиатуры). Заполните текущими датами колонку C до конца таблицы.
    5. Диапазон ячеек D2:D4 заполните так как показано ниже на рисунке.
    6. В ячейке D5 введите первую буку «п», а дальше слово заполнят не надо. Достаточно нажать клавишу Enter.
    7. В ячейке D6 после ввода первой буквы «н» не отображается часть слова для авто-заполнения. Поэтому нажмите комбинацию ALT+(стрела вниз), чтобы появился выпадающий список. Выберите стрелками клавиатуры или указателем мышки значение «наличными в кассе» и нажмите Enter.

    Такой полуавтоматический способ ввода данных позволяет в несколько раз ускорить и облегчить процесс работы с таблицами.

    Внимание! Если значение состоит из нескольких строк, то при нажатии на комбинацию ALT+(стрела вниз) оно не будет отображаться в выпадающем списке значений.

    Разбить значение на строки можно с помощью комбинации клавиш ALT+Enter. Таким образом, текст делится на строки в рамках одной ячейки.

    Разбиение ячейки на 2 строки.

    Примечание. Обратите внимание, как мы вводили текущую дату в пункте 4 с помощью горячих клавиш (CTRL+;). Это очень удобно! А при нажатии CTRL+SHIFT+; мы получаем текущее время.

    Автозаполнение ячеек в Excel

    Автозаполнение ячеек Excel – это автоматический ввод серии данных в некоторый диапазон. Введем в ячейку «Понедельник», затем удерживая левой кнопкой мышки маркер автозаполнения (квадратик в правом нижнем углу), тянем вниз (или в другую сторону). Результатом будет список из дней недели. Можно использовать краткую форму типа Пн, Вт, Ср и т.д. Эксель поймет. Аналогичным образом создается список из названий месяцев.

    Автозаполнение дней недели в Excel

    Автоматическое заполнение ячеек также используют для продления последовательности чисел c заданным шагом (арифметическая прогрессия). Чтобы сделать список нечетных чисел, нужно в двух ячейках указать 1 и 3, затем выделить обе ячейки и протянуть вниз.

    Автозаполнение последовательности чисел в Excel

    Эксель также умеет распознать числа среди текста. Так, легко создать перечень кварталов. Введем в ячейку «1 квартал» и протянем вниз.

    На этом познания об автозаполнении у большинства пользователей Эксель заканчиваются. Но это далеко не все, и далее будут рассмотрены другие эффективные и интересные приемы.

    Автозаполнение в Excel из списка данных

    Ясно, что кроме дней недели и месяцев могут понадобиться другие списки. Допустим, часто приходится вводить перечень городов, где находятся сервисные центры компании: Минск, Гомель, Брест, Гродно, Витебск, Могилев, Москва, Санкт-Петербург, Воронеж, Ростов-на-Дону, Смоленск, Белгород. Вначале нужно создать и сохранить (в нужном порядке) полный список названий. Заходим в Файл – Параметры – Дополнительно – Общие – Изменить списки.

    Изменить списки для автозаполнения в Excel

    В следующем открывшемся окне видны те списки, которые существуют по умолчанию.

    Диалоговое окно для изменения списков в Excel

    Как видно, их не много. Но легко добавить свой собственный. Можно воспользоваться окном справа, где либо через запятую, либо столбцом перечислить нужную последовательность. Однако быстрее будет импортировать, особенно, если данных много. Для этого предварительно где-нибудь на листе Excel создаем перечень названий, затем делаем на него ссылку и нажимаем Импорт.

    Добавление нового списка

    Жмем ОК. Список создан, можно изпользовать для автозаполнения.

    Помимо текстовых списков чаще приходится создавать последовательности чисел и дат. Один из вариантов был рассмотрен в начале статьи, но это примитивно. Есть более интересные приемы. Вначале нужно выделить одно или несколько первых значений серии, а также диапазон (вправо или вниз), куда будет продлена последовательность значений. Далее вызываем диалоговое окно прогрессии: Главная – Заполнить – Прогрессия.

    Команда Прогрессия в Excel

    Настройки диалогового окна Прогрессия

    В левой части окна с помощью переключателя задается направление построения последовательности: вниз (по строкам) или вправо (по столбцам).

    Посередине выбирается нужный тип:

    • арифметическая прогрессия – каждое последующее значение изменяется на число, указанное в поле Шаг
    • геометрическая прогрессия – каждое последующее значение умножается на число, указанное в поле Шаг
    • даты – создает последовательность дат. При выборе этого типа активируются переключатели правее, где можно выбрать тип единицы измерения. Есть 4 варианта:
        • день – перечень календарных дат (с указанным ниже шагом)
        • рабочий день – последовательность рабочих дней (пропускаются выходные)
        • месяц – меняются только месяцы (число фиксируется, как в первой ячейке)
        • год – меняются только годы
        • автозаполнение – эта команда равносильная протягиванию с помощью левой кнопки мыши. То есть эксель сам определяет: то ли ему продолжить последовательность чисел, то ли продлить список. Если предварительно заполнить две ячейки значениями 2 и 4, то в других выделенных ячейках появится 6, 8 и т.д. Если предварительно заполнить больше ячеек, то Excel рассчитает приближение методом линейной регрессии, т.е. прогноз по прямой линии тренда (интереснейшая функция – подробнее см. ниже).

        Нижняя часть окна Прогрессия служит для того, чтобы создать последовательность любой длины на основании конечного значения и шага. Например, нужно заполнить столбец последовательностью четных чисел от 2 до 1000. Мышкой протягивать не удобно. Поэтому предварительно нужно выделить только ячейку с одним первым значением. Далее в окне Прогрессия указываем Расположение, Шаг и Предельное значение.

        Предельное значение в прогрессии

        Результатом будет заполненный столбец от 2 до 1000. Аналогичным образом можно сделать последовательность рабочих дней на год вперед (предельным значением нужно указать последнюю дату, например 31.12.2016). Возможность заполнять столбец (или строку) с указанием последнего значения очень полезная штука, т.к. избавляет от кучи лишних действий во время протягивания. На этом настройки автозаполнения заканчиваются. Идем далее.

        Автозаполнение чисел с помощью мыши

        Автозаполнение в Excel удобнее делать мышкой, у которой есть правая и левая кнопка. Понадобятся обе.

        Допустим, нужно сделать порядковые номера чисел, начиная с 1. Обычно заполняют две ячейки числами 1 и 2, а далее левой кнопкой мыши протягивают арифметическую прогрессию. Можно сделать по-другому. Заполняем только одну ячейку с 1. Протягиваем ее и получим столбец с единицами. Далее открываем квадратик, который появляется сразу после протягивания в правом нижнем углу и выбираем Заполнить.

        Если выбрать Заполнить только форматы, будут продлены только форматы ячеек.
        Сделать последовательность чисел можно еще быстрее. Во время протягивания ячейки, удерживаем кнопку Ctrl.

        Этот трюк работает только с последовательностью чисел. В других ситуациях удерживание Ctrl приводит к копированию данных вместо автозаполнения.

        Если при протягивании использовать правую кнопку мыши, то контекстное меню открывается сразу после отпускания кнопки.

        Автозаполнение с помощью правой кнопки мыши

        При этом добавляются несколько команд. Прогрессия позволяет использовать дополнительные операции автозаполнения (настройки см. выше). Правда, диапазон получается выделенным и длина последовательности будет ограничена последней ячейкой.

        Чтобы произвести автозаполнение до необходимого предельного значения (числа или даты), можно проделать следующий трюк. Берем правой кнопкой мыши за маркер чуть оттягиваем вниз, сразу возвращаем назад и отпускаем кнопку – открывается контекстное меню автозаполнения. Выбираем прогрессию. На этот раз выделена только одна ячейка, поэтому указываем направление, шаг, предельное значение и создаем нужную последовательность.

        Очень интересными являются пункты меню Линейное и Экспоненциальное приближение. Это экстраполяция, т.е. прогнозирование, данных по указанной модели (линейной или экспоненциальной). Обычно для прогноза используют специальные функции Excel или предварительно рассчитывают уравнение тренда (регрессии), в которое подставляют значения независимой переменной для будущих периодов и таким образом рассчитывают прогнозное значение. Делается примерно так. Допустим, есть динамика показателя с равномерным ростом.

        Данные для с равномерным ростом

        Для прогнозирования подойдет линейный тренд. Расчет параметров уравнения можно осуществить с помощью функций Excel, но часто для наглядности используют диаграмму с настройками отображения линии тренда, уравнения и прогнозных значений.

        Прогноз с помощью линейного тренда на диаграмме

        Чтобы получить прогноз в числовом выражении, нужно произвести расчет на основе полученного уравнения регрессии (либо напрямую обратиться к формулам Excel). Таким образом, получается довольно много действий, требующих при этом хорошего понимания.

        Так вот прогноз по методу линейной регрессии можно сделать вообще без формул и без графиков, используя только автозаполнение ячеек в экселе. Для этого выделяем данные, по которым строится прогноз, протягиваем правой кнопкой мыши на нужное количество ячеек, соответствующее длине прогноза, и выбираем Линейное приближение. Получаем прогноз. Без шума, пыли, формул и диаграмм.

        Если данные имеют ускоряющийся рост (как счет на депозите), то можно использовать экспоненциальную модель. Вновь, чтобы не мучиться с вычислениями, можно воспользоваться автозаполнением, выбрав Экспоненциальное приближение.

        Прогноз по методу экспоненциального приближения

        Более быстрого способа прогнозирования, пожалуй, не придумаешь.

        Автозаполнение дат с помощью мыши

        Довольно часто требуется продлить список дат. Берем дату и тащим левой кнопкой мыши. Открываем квадратик и выбираем способ заполнения.

        Автозаполнение дат в Excel с помощью мыши

        По рабочим дням – отличный вариант для бухгалтеров, HR и других специалистов, кто имеет дело с составлением различных планов. А вот другой пример. Допустим, платежи по графику наступают 15-го числа и в последний день каждого месяца. Укажем первые две даты, протянем вниз и заполним по месяцам (любой кнопкой мыши).

        Автозаполнение по месяцам

        Обратите внимание, что 15-е число фиксируется, а последний день месяца меняется, чтобы всегда оставаться последним.

        Используя правую кнопку мыши, можно воспользоваться настройками прогрессии. Например, сделать список рабочих дней до конца года. В перечне команд через правую кнопку есть еще Мгновенное заполнение. Эта функция появилась в Excel 2013. Используется для заполнения ячеек по образцу. Но об этом уже была статья, рекомендую ознакомиться. Также поможет сэкономить не один час работы.

        На этом, пожалуй, все. В видеоуроке показано, как сделать автозаполнение ячеек в Excel.

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*